    Taz went through a not-eating stage a few months ago and we tried changing his food. We changed it about 3 times and I was just worried about changing it SOOO much. Finally, we found a food he could eat and keep down. It is only available through a vet, but it is Purina Veterinary Diets z/d. This is a food for sensitive stomachs. But of course, what worked for my cat doesn't mean it will work for Amber.
